Agoraphobia
An anxiety disorder characterized by an intense fear of being in situations where escape might be difficult or help might not be available.
Panic Disorder
A psychiatric disorder characterized by unexpected and repeated episodes of intense fear accompanied by physical symptoms that may include chest pain, heart palpitations, shortness of breath, dizziness, or abdominal distress.
Bipolar Disorder
A psychological disorder marked by significant fluctuations in mood, ranging from periods of intense happiness (mania or hypomania) to profound sadness (depression).
Schizophrenia
A chronic brain disorder characterized by symptoms such as delusions, hallucinations, disorganized speech, and impaired cognitive ability.
